AI Intensifies Competition in Software Engineering Interviews

Artificial intelligence is increasingly influencing software engineering job interviews, with candidates using AI tools to enhance their coding skills and performance. This shift is creating a competitive environment where both applicants and employers must adapt to AI-driven changes.
